I tried this place because I saw it when I was in the Brooks shopping plaza. I'm so glad I did, this is the best BBQ I have had that was not in somebody's backyard. I got the Brisket dinner, with mac and cheese, and baked beans, and also ordered the cornbread waffle. I ordered the waffle thinking it was just a piece of cornbread cooked in a waffle iron. NOPE!!! It was a whole dang waffle, I laughed at myself thinking otherwise. The brisket had a beautiful smoke ring and a delicious bark with the flavor of the wood emanating from it. The smoke ring was so pretty, I almost thought the owner was trying to propose to me using his smoked brisket. Mac and cheese, baked beans... He had Mama and Grandmama back in the kitchen cooking. The flavour and seasoning were awesome, creamy cheese, in the mac, and bits of BBQ meat in the baked beans. If you are looking for a good home-grown BBQ with flavor, go to Triple D BBQ and getcha some, you will not be disappointed... By the way, I ate the cornbread waffle with some butter and cane syrup, which was off-the-chain delicious.
